ART 106 — Introduction to Mural Painting and Design

3 credits · 3 hours

This course is designed for students that have an interest in producing art in a public context and/or public art through a commissioning process. The course will cover several aspects and methods used in the production of public art works. Issues examined will include proposal, design, budget, procuring materials, safety concerns, methods, and installation. Students will implement artistic skills, techniques and concepts to design and produce murals or other works collaboratively for public context. (CSU/UC)
